Presentation Mode
Problem
Presenters need to show the grid on an external display or projector while keeping controls visible on their primary screen.
Solution
Presentation Mode opens a separate borderless output window that can be moved to any connected display. The main window retains all controls while the output window shows only the grid content.
UI Flow
- Connect an external display or projector.
- Enable via View > Presentation Mode or the toolbar button.
- Drag the output window to the external display.
- Control content, scenes, and layouts from the main window.
- Close the output window or toggle off to exit.

Known Limitations
- Output window inherits the main window’s grid layout and content; independent layouts are not supported.
- Display arrangement must be configured in System Settings before use.
